Surrender of Demised Premises. At the earlier termination of the Term, Xxxxxx shall surrender the Demised Premises in good order, condition and repair, reasonable wear and tear, condemnation and matters for which Landlord is expressly responsible under this Lease excepted, and shall surrender all keys to the Demised Premises to Landlord at the place then fixed for the payment of Base Rent and shall inform Landlord of all combinations on locks, safes and vaults, if any. Tenant shall at such time remove all of its property therefrom. Tenant shall repair any damage to the Demised Premises caused by such removal. Tenant hereby appoints Landlord its agent to remove all property of Tenant from the Demised Premises upon an early termination of this Lease and to cause its transportation and storage for Tenant's benefit, all at the sole cost and risk of Tenant and Landlord shall not be liable for damage, theft, misappropriation or loss thereof and Landlord shall not be liable in any manner in respect thereto, except for the gross negligence or willful acts of the Landlord Parties. Tenant shall pay all costs and expenses of such removal, transportation and storage. Tenant shall reimburse Landlord upon demand for any expenses incurred by Landlord with respect to removal or storage of abandoned property and with respect to restoring such Demised Premises to good order, condition and repair.
